Languages

Whenever you run out of the ideas about what to learn, pick a language that you like and start learning it. Try to get it to the highest level of knowledge possible, but at least reach the point where you can have a simple conversation on that language. This will do wonders for your satisfaction, confidence and it will keep your mind fresh. Also, learning more languages allows you wider window into the art of communication and that is something that a successful businessman simply has to have. Knowing a little about language and culture of a foreign contact will do wonders to that particular relationship.

Computer Skills

You don’t have to be a wizard that can fix any sort of computer issue or write programs for your company. However, you will be forced to pick some software solutions, applications, hardware and the like. You will hardly make good choices if you don’t have the proper knowledge about computers. Not to mention that you really need to know how to use them as you cannot really imagine any of the business processes without computers.

Basic SEO

It is almost unimaginable that a business today exists without the website. The entire branch of marketing is based on the websites and the online marketing. What makes your website stand out and rank high on the list of search results is the search engine optimization. There are experts in this area and they are really good, but you should know at least the basics about it in order to be able to keep up to date with all those trends that influence the online part of your business.

Basic Accounting

You should definitely hire an accountant to do their work for you if you are not the professional accountant. That is just too delicate part of any business to be left to amateurs. However, it is not a good idea to be kept in dark about such an important aspect of your company, so get some training so that you can be informed and that you can talk to the accountant and actually know what they are talking to you. It is a very good idea to keep the uni notes from these types of courses as these info are really hard to keep in your head at all times and you can use them as reminders.

Leadership Skills

Once all those people are in your company, they expect you to be their leader and to lead them and the company. There are many types of leaders and you need to make sure that you know your type of leadership skills, your good and bad sides and how to make them all work for you and your company. Being a good leader for your company may well made all the difference about the company’s success or failure. If the company is yours then you should definitely go to some of the leadership trainings and motivate the people that are on the key positions in your company to take these courses as well.
